[EnergyPlus_Support] Leveraging the Python language in Building Performance Simulation



Dear simulation community,

The Python programming language is well known as a powerful tool in automation, scripting, and high performance scientific computing. In our experience, countless hours have been saved in automating building simulation tasks, allowing us to focus more on creating quality building models and accurate performance results. 

We believe that Python is positioned to make a big difference in the building simulation community. To get started, we have the following offer: Send us your scripting problems, and we will solve them for you! 

In this phase, we are interested most in small well defined tasks. Example problems would be;

"In my research, I need to parametrize 100 EnergyPlus files with different U-Values"
"We need to convert 1000 files from format *.yyy to format *.qqq" 
"Our company produces a report for each project, we use Excel to calculate the average Lux levels from radiance, it's easy but boring after 100 projects"
Or anything else where you think - "I wish I had an intern do this for me..." (Maybe you are this intern...)
